So I went to STEELE yesterday.
Best of the day was a 14.66 with a 2.4 60 foot.
The track was cold and I didn't get any traction all night. I usually hit 2.2s on my 60' all the time. I didnt hit it at all last night. 2.3s were my norm. Even if I didnt spin at the line I would still spin starting at about 4000 rpm all the way to red line in first gear.
I tried to throttle back a few times...nothing worked
i couldnt not spin
so based on a 2.4 with a 14.6 i figure my car is capable of 14.3 in optimal conditions
i mean a 2.2 is a 14.4 right there and i have heard that .1 on the 60 foot is equal to .2 or more off your 1/4 mile time.
